Can the Elliptical Machine Replace Exercises for the Lower Body?
It may be convenient to replace lower body exercises with the elliptical machine for both strength and cardio training but it’s not an ideal switch. While the elliptical is effective for cardio, it lacks the muscle and bone strengthening properties of weight-bearing leg exercises. Think twice before ditching squats and leg curls because the elliptical doesn’t deliver the same health benefits.
